  • Work Location: Liberty Village, Toronto
  • Job Type & Duration: Part-time Internship, 4 Months from January to April 2026
  • Compensation: Paid Internship, $17.75/hour
  • Work Arrangement: At least three (3) days per week in office, 9AM to 5PM, up to 37.5 hours a week
  • The Partner Development department manages relationships with our Digital Streaming Platform (DSP) and retail partners including Spotify, Apple Music, YouTube, Amazon, and key independent retailers, with the goal of driving sustainable growth for our artists and overall business. We are seeking a motivated and detail-oriented intern to join our Partner Development team on a short-term basis. As a Partner Development intern, you will assist in supporting DSP partnerships, catalog strategy, and retail activations, while learning how artist campaigns come to life across streaming platforms and storefronts.
  • The Role
  • Analyze performance data from digital and physical platforms (Spotify, Apple Music, YouTube, Amazon, and retailers) to identify trends, growth opportunities, and performance insights.
  • Support playlist and content strategy and ensuring alignment with brand tone, artist identity, and audience objectives.
  • Contribute to innovation and research initiatives related to independent retailers, physical product development, and digital consumption trends.
  • Assist in maintaining accuracy and product information across vendor storefronts, release schedules, and partner pitches.
  • Monitor industry developments and best practices across both the streaming and physical sectors, tracking new features, editorial opportunities, and partner updates.
  • Collaborate cross-functionally with marketing, commercial, and operations teams to support release rollouts and partner campaigns.

Ideal Candidate

  • Currently enrolled in a post-secondary or training program focused on music industry studies, sales, entertainment business, or marketing.
  • Strong analytical and organizational skills.
  • Tech and social-media-savvy, with a strong understanding of how digital platforms and retail channels connect fans to music.
  • Creative thinker with a passion for music and an interest in how streaming platforms shape artist discovery.
  • Professional, proactive, and collaborative, with excellent communication and interpersonal skills.
  • Highly detail oriented and adaptable in a fast paced, evolving environment.
  • Familiarity with the Canadian music landscape, including record labels, DSP ecosystem is a strong asset.
